Frequently asked questions

What is Page realty - 11-15 45th Avenue's energy grade?

Page realty - 11-15 45th Avenue scores 64 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band C (Below median (55–69)) — in its 2024 New York City dis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does Page realty - 11-15 45th Avenue use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 87.9 kBtu/ft² (112.9 kBtu/ft² source) across 25,800 sq ft, including 101,123 kWh of electricity and 925 therms of natural gas.

What are Page realty - 11-15 45th Avenue's carbon emissions?

Page realty - 11-15 45th Avenue reported 180 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(7.0 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.
